February Weather in Clarksville, United States

Last updated: June 24, 2025

In February, the average temperature in Clarksville, United States hovers around -7°C (20°F). However, temperatures can swing dramatically, with minimums reaching as low as -35°C (-30°F) and highs peaking at 20°C (68°F). Expect around 48 mm (1.9 in) of precipitation over 8 days, accompanied by a high average humidity of 84%, making for a chilly and damp atmosphere.

How February Weather in Clarksville Compares to Other Months

Weather in Clarksville var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ares February’s weather to other months in Clarksville,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in Clarksville, showing how February’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ather-7°C (20°F)39 mm (1.5 inches)82%moderate
February Weather-7°C (20°F)48 mm (1.9 inches)84%moderate
March Weather2°C (36°F)72 mm (2.8 inches)80%moderate
April Weather8°C (47°F)77 mm (3.0 inches)81%very high
May Weather16°C (61°F)155 mm (6.1 inches)74%very high
June Weather22°C (73°F)118 mm (4.7 inches)80%extreme
July Weather24°C (75°F)96 mm (3.8 inches)80%very high
August Weather22°C (71°F)112 mm (4.4 inches)77%very high
September Weather19°C (66°F)109 mm (4.3 inches)75%very high
October Weather10°C (51°F)129 mm (5.1 inches)80%moderate
November Weather2°C (36°F)47 mm (1.9 inches)87%moderate
December Weather-2°C (29°F)35 mm (1.4 inches)83%moderate
